TV star Jeremy Clarkson is set to host a new spin-off of his popular game show Who Wants to Be a Millionaire.

The former Top Gear and Grand Tour presenter, who is already familiar to audiences as host of the ITV series, is preparing to launch a fresh spin-off titled Millionaire Hot Seat.

Billed as a "thrilling fast-paced twist" on the long-running programme, the new ITV offering promises to deliver "a new fix of high-stakes excitement".

Yet the format comes with a warning - it is described as "ruthless", requiring participants to display "quick thinking, tactical play, and nerves of steel" if they hope to triumph.

Unlike the original format, where a single contestant competes alone, this version will feature six players competing head-to-head, according to the Mirror.

They will race against time in pursuit of potentially life-altering prize money.

In Millionaire Hot Seat, every moment matters as competitors take turns occupying the chair opposite Jeremy, progressing up the Million Pound Money Ladder question by question.

Correct answers keep players in contention, whilst wrong responses mean elimination and a reduction in the top prize.

Participants may opt to pass and remain in the running, although this places them at the rear of the queue, with the risk of never returning to the hot seat.

The Clarkson's Farm presenter has been the host of TV hit Who Wants To Be A Millionaire? since 2018.

He assumed hosting duties when the programme returned to screens four years after its previous presenter, Chris Tarrant, stepped down following an extensive run and several series. Earlier this year, it was revealed that Jeremy would also take on the role of host for Millionaire Hot Seat.

The new programme is a follow-up to successful iterations of the show that have been broadcast in countries like Italy and Australia.

The show has enjoyed immense popularity with audiences in Australia, having first aired in 2009 and subsequently running for multiple seasons.

Who Wants To Be A Millionaire? airs on ITV and Millionaire Hot Seat will also air on the channel.
